Andy Serkis’ marathon charity reading of The Hobbit attracted more than 650,000 viewers. The star, 56, best known for playing Gollum in The Lord Of The Rings and Hobbit films, finished the JRR Tolkein novel in 11 hours and raised more than £280,000 for charity.
Not too shabby, Andy! The actor – who admitted to Metro.co.uk that he wasn’t sure how he would ‘wee’ during the reading – said he was ‘truly humbled’ by the response to his reading.
After he finished, he added: ‘It has been wonderful connecting with you all, I hope you all enjoyed it.
